DPR Announces Joint Technology Agreement With M*Modal to Boost Radiologist Productivity

DPR, a technology company that delivers intelligent imaging informatics solutions for the radiology industry, today announced it has entered into an agreement with M*Modal™, (MModal Inc.) MODL, a leading provider of clinical documentation services and Speech Understanding™ technologies. DPR has embedded M*Modal Fluency Direct™ technology, which fully leverages the contextual understanding of a physician's narrative, into CaseReader™, a highly advanced intelligent post-processing, structured reporting software solution. Integrating the products dramatically improves the efficiency, effectiveness and accuracy of managing, analyzing and organizing CT, PET-CT and MRI images. CaseReader is fully integrated with M*Modal's technology for voice-driven navigation and dictation, which allows radiologists to complete more exams on a given day and produce reports more quickly. CaseReader also integrates with the RIS, PACS and the 2D viewing application resulting in a linkage whereby measurements are systematically captured within CaseReader and into the final report. This next generation reporting vehicle helps the radiologist lower costs, reduce the potential for errors and, while working in collaboration with the referring physician, save patients' lives.
